the consequences of half assing it

So I needed a new sheath for the front trunk release cable in the six. I got one & figured it was a quick install. Jackass. Fortunately, I had to cut a hole in the front trunk anyway- need an exit for the oil cooler. Cut a hole in the floor of the front trunk of a six, sad.gif , poped the hood, re-installed the cable release properly this time, dry.gif , cut & welded in a repro of the factory air exit plate on the 916 & GT. Needs cleaning & repainting but so does the whole car. Plate is double bead welded in so it's not going anywhere. I figure I'll just keep fixing everything & test fitting all my mods before I take it all apart & repaint the whole car. At least I get to enjoy it that way. Put 245 miles on her today; I must be getting around 16mpg in this pig. It's not a 4!! Fun driving.gif ! Got a headlight that's not working. Turn signals & horn stopped working as well- loose cables or a bad relay. Going to weld a new battery tray & support back in the engine bay & get rid of the front battery next. I hate bugs.
